How to Make These Strawberry Muffins.
To make the muffins, start by mixing the granulated sugar with the lemon and orange zest. Combining the two first instead of just mixing them with all the other ingredients really brings out the citrus flavor. In a bowl, mix all the dry ingredients, including the sugar mixture. Whisk flour, sugar, baking powder, salt, cinnamon, and the black pepper in a large bowl until well mixed. Slightly smash strawberries in large bowl, using fork.
